Cybersecurity Best Practices: Fortifying Your Digital Defenses

In today's dynamic digital landscape, safeguarding your data and systems is paramount. Implementing robust cybersecurity best practices is essential for mitigating the risks of cyberattacks and securing your valuable assets. A strong cybersecurity posture involves a multi-layered approach that includes various aspects, from configuring secure passwords to installing advanced threat detection systems.

  • Periodically update your software and operating systems to patch vulnerabilities and protect against known threats.
  • Activate multi-factor authentication (MFA) for all critical accounts to add an extra layer of security.
  • Train yourself and your employees about common cybersecurity threats and best practices to promote a culture of security awareness.
  • Monitor your network traffic for suspicious activity and deploy intrusion detection systems (IDS) to identify potential threats.
  • Archive your data regularly to ensure you can recover in case of a ransomware attack or other data loss event.

By adhering to these cybersecurity best practices, you can significantly enhance your digital defenses and protect your organization from the ever-evolving threat landscape.
